What companies run services between Marina di Sibari, Italy and Verona, Italy?

Trenitalia Frecce operates a train from Sibari to Verona Porta Nuova every 4 hours. Tickets cost €150–300 and the journey takes 7h 44m. Alternatively, Onebus operates a bus from Sibari to Verona Porta Nuova Station twice a week, and the journey takes 9h 30m.
